Almost 300 evacuated from Rock Creek wildfire

About 300 tourists and residents evacuated from Rock Creek moved to a reception centre at the Midway Community Hall.

Residents on the Highway 33 corridor were taken to the Kelowna Salvation Army on Sutherland Road.

The Lumby reception centre for Christian Valley evacuees is Whiteville Community Centre.

270 homes have been evacuated to this point.

John Maclean with the Regional District of Kootenay Boundary says it was a challenging night.

The RCMP is patrolling evacuated areas to ensure safety and security.
